I am growing one photoperiod a 36 inch x20 x63 tent under a Mars hydro 600w led in 3gal fabric pots using foxfarm soil mixed half ffof and happy frog with added perlite, the plant was given to me as a seedling about a week old around the first or second week in July it has been under 18/6. I only gave tap water without phing when the soil was dry and great white mycorrhizae once or twice until 3 weeks ago when I noticed yellow bottom leaves when I started using the fox farm cultivation nation veggie at half strength, and 4ml of cal mag in store bought water and most of the yellow has recovered, I'm planning on switching to 12/12 in a week or so I'm wondering if I should use the open seasame and beastie blooms or the cultivation nation 2nd part flower, or a combination and when do I stop using the veggie? Any help comments questions or feedback is greatly appreciated

Hello and thank you for posting all the info about the grow it sure helps us help you. :) Me personally do not use so much product so i'm thinking it's way overloaded and does not need anything but lots of defoiliation and thinning of tiny branches. See the last pic with your finger all those tiny shoots just take up bigger branches where you want the colas to form their buds. They take energy away from the bud colas. This past Sunday great article about defoliation and thinning please read it. Your plant can be switched now. I'm thinking it is going to grow much wider and taller ( super crop it ) post light switch, at least 6" then you need to super crop.
 
I am with SoOrbudgal, I only use one product and use it sparingly. You could use some defoliation prior to switching to 12/12. A few weeks after the plant stretches out, defoliate again.
